What are the duties of sorting assistant?
As we have stated earlier, the main function of Sorting Assistant is to sort mails. The mails sent by various locations will be sent to the RMS (Railway Mail Service). There our Sorting Assistant has to divide and sort the mails according to pincodes. Being SA you have to work in shifts.

What is the grade pay of Postman?
The BCR level postman receives basic pay scale of Rs. 4500/- that grows up to Rs….Postman/Mail Guard, Post Master Pay Scale – Quick Review.
Post | Pay scale | Grade Pay |
---|---|---|
Postman(TBOP) | 4000/–6000/- | 2400/- |
Postman(BCR) | 4500/–7000/- | 2800/- |
Postmaster(Grade-1) | 4500/–7000/- | 2800/- |
Postmaster(Grade-2) | 5000/–8000/- | 4200/- |

What is a closed card sorting session?
In a closed card sorting session, participants are provided with a predetermined set of category names. They then assign the index cards to these fixed categories. This helps reveal the degree to which the participants agree on which cards belong under each category.
